C’est la rentrée!

It’s all over. And that’s official. Summer, that is. In France. At the beginning of September, the summer holidays are officially over. The schools go back, government ministers and civil servants return to their desks, even the social clubs start up again after their two-month hiatus. And there’s currently a heatwave. Hello again

Most people with even a passing acquaintance with France will know the French word for ‘hello’: ‘bonjour’ (literally ‘good day’). However, maybe not so many will be aware of how crucial an element of social intercourse that simple word really is.
